The Role of OEM Manufacturers in Producing Heavy-Duty Slurry Pumps


In the industrial sector, slurry pumps are essential components used in various applications—from mining and mineral processing to wastewater management and power generation. These pumps are designed to handle abrasive and viscous materials that traditional pumps cannot manage effectively. Given the growing demand for durable and efficient solutions, the role of Original Equipment Manufacturers (OEMs) in producing heavy-duty slurry pumps has become increasingly significant.


Understanding Heavy-Duty Slurry Pumps


Heavy-duty slurry pumps are specifically engineered to transport slurries—mixtures of solids and liquids commonly found in industries like mining, construction, and dredging. These pumps must withstand extreme wear and tear due to the abrasive nature of the materials they handle, which often include rock particles, sand, and other heavy substances. As such, they are constructed from high-quality metals and polymers that can resist corrosion and erosion.


Key Features of Heavy-Duty Slurry Pumps


1. Durability The materials used in fabrication often include high-chrome iron, rubber-lined options, and specialized alloys. These features ensure that the pumps have a long operational life even under harsh working conditions.


2. High Efficiency Heavy-duty slurry pumps are designed to optimize hydraulic performance, maintaining high efficiency even with varying flow rates. This efficiency is essential not just for operational effectiveness but also for energy savings.


3. Versatility These pumps can handle a wide range of slurries, including those with high solid content. The adaptability of slurry pumps to various applications makes them valuable assets in many industrial sectors.


4. Customizability Many OEM manufacturers offer customization options, allowing businesses to tailor pumps to meet specific needs based on the type of slurry, flow rates, and system configurations.


The Role of OEM Manufacturers


OEM manufacturers play a crucial role in the production of heavy-duty slurry pumps. They are responsible for the design, development, and manufacturing processes that ensure these pumps meet industry standards and client specifications. Below are some of the key responsibilities and contributions of OEMs in this niche market

1. Innovative Design and Engineering OEMs invest in research and development to create innovative designs that enhance the performance and efficiency of slurry pumps. This includes employing advanced computational fluid dynamics (CFD) and finite element analysis (FEA) to optimize pump geometries and predict operational behaviors.


2. Quality Control OEMs maintain rigorous quality control standards throughout the manufacturing process. This commitment ensures that each pump meets the required specifications and performs reliably in demanding environments.


3. Customization and Solutions Many OEMs offer tailored solutions to meet unique customer needs. This customization can involve specific materials, configurations, or features that enhance the pump's ability to handle particular types of slurries.


4. Support and Service Beyond manufacturing, OEMs often provide support services, including installation, maintenance, and repair. This additional support is crucial for ensuring the longevity and reliability of slurry pumps in the field.


5. Sustainability Initiatives With increasing environmental concerns, many OEMs are focusing on producing energy-efficient and less environmentally damaging slurry pumps. This involves the use of sustainable materials and technologies aimed at minimizing carbon footprints in manufacturing and operation.


Challenges and Future Trends


Despite the advancements in the slurry pump manufacturing process, OEMs face challenges, such as fluctuating material costs and increasing competition from low-cost manufacturers. Furthermore, as industries continue to evolve, the demand for smarter and more integrated pump solutions rises.


The future of heavy-duty slurry pumps may see the integration of IoT (Internet of Things) technology to monitor pumps in real-time, providing data on their performance and maintenance needs. Such intelligent systems can drastically improve operational efficiency and reduce downtime.
